PORTSMOUTH — The Portsmouth Town Council Monday night unanimously approved a memorandum of understanding with the Church Community Housing Corp. to develop a plan to create a new senior center and housing units at the former Anne Hutchinson School on Bristol Ferry Road.
The former school, which now serves as the Portsmouth Multi-Purpose Senior Center, must be vacated by June 30 because of the poor condition of the 95-year-old building.
